Pro Circuit Pushes Through Toronto
CORONA, Calif., - Over 47,000 fans packed into the Rogers Centre in Toronto, Ontario, on Saturday for an exciting night of Monster Energy Supercross. The Monster Energy/Pro Circuit/Kawasaki duo of Darryn Durham and Blake Baggett each had a frustrating night in the Supercross Lites East division, while teammate Broc Tickle stayed consistent and earned his third top-10 finish in three weeks in the Supercross Class.
Both Durham and Baggett rocketed out of the gate in their respective Supercross Lites heat races. Durham dominated his heat by first grabbing the holeshot and then taking the win. Baggett also looked strong, finishing third. Both riders were feeling confident as they prepared for the Supercross Lites Main Event.
Durham positioned himself in third after the start of main event, while Baggett trailed a few spots behind. Durham was looking fast and kept the pressure on as he hunted down the competition. He was in the midst of battle for the podium when he went down in a corner, but remounted and put on a charge to salvage valuable points. Darryn finished fifth, and now sits third overall in the Supercross Lites East Region standings.
Baggett had a mid-pack start in the main event, and was starting to move through the field when he collided with a rider who had crashed only moments before. The incident set Baggett back a few positions, and he ended the night with a 15th-place finish. Blake is now sixth overall in the Supercross Lites East Region standings.
Tickle is starting to find his stride in the Supercross Class, and earned his third top-10 finish in three weeks. Broc is staying consistent and plugging away at each round, and plans on improving even more in the rounds to come. With five races remaining this season, Tickle sits 11th overall in the Supercross Class standings, with 108 points.
The Monster Energy/Pro Circuit/Kawasaki Race Team now makes its way to Houston for the next round of Monster Energy Supercross, which will be held at Reliant Stadium this Saturday, March 31.
